The Fighter's Path
Zaur's competitive career reads like a highlight reel. Three world championship titles in kickboxing, years of elite-level competition, and the kind of fight IQ that only comes from hundreds of rounds under pressure.
But what separates Zaur from other former champions is what he did next — he didn't retire into obscurity or coast on his name. He moved to Dubai and built a coaching practice from the ground up, applying the same discipline that made him a champion to the craft of developing others.

Who He Works With
Zaur offers both private one-on-one sessions and small group training. His clients range from competitive fighters preparing for bouts to fitness enthusiasts who want the intensity and structure of a real combat athlete's training without stepping into the ring.
